​​Swim Team: The Meadowmoor Manta Rays' swim team is a merger of the Meadowood and Co-Moor communities. The team competes within the guidelines of the Strongsville Swim League (SSL) and the season runs from late May to mid-July. The team is always looking for new members ages 5-18, and parent/family volunteers are always welcome! Visit meadowmoorswim.com for all Manta Rays' team information including sign ups, practices, and meet schedules.

Pool Safety: Lifeguards are required to close the pool for 30 minutes following the last instance of thunder and/or lightning. The clock restarts when new thunder is heard or lightning is seen by the pool staff. If lightning is spotted, all bathers must leave the facility until no other visible instances of lightning have occurred. See complete list of Pool Rules.

Pool Passes: We use a photo-based recognition system for each visit. We ask that residents who are new to Meadowood, or, have not attended the pool in several years, provide proof-of-address information at their first visit only: i.e., a utility bill, home ownership document, or rental agreement (if renting). Each resident household is allotted 40 guest passes per season.

Tennis & Pickleball
Two full-sized courts are adjacent to pool, clubhouse and playground and are lined for tennis and pickleball. Courts are open April 1st - October 31st. In consideration of surrounding residents, courts are not lighted for play after dark.
